Is Fresno’s Low-Kill Animal Shelter Policy Endangering Public Health?
When the city changed its contracted animal shelter in 2022, it also changed how it would address stray animals. Gone were the years of notably high euthanasia rates, favoring instead tracing animals back to their homes, Fresno Deputy City Manager Alma Torres told the Fresno City Council that year. Taking...

Tesla’s Annual Car Sales Slip for First Time as EV Competition Grows
Tesla sales fell slightly in 2024, the first annual decline in the company’s history, as rivals in China, Europe and the United States introduced dozens of competing electric models, giving buyers more choice. The company said Thursday that it delivered 1,789,226 vehicles worldwide during the year, a slight decline from...
